1. Understand Your Budget Beyond the Purchase Price
Many first-time buyers focus primarily on the property's purchase price, but ownership involves additional financial considerations. Understanding the full picture can help you make informed decisions and avoid unexpected surprises.
Creating a realistic budget before beginning your search can help narrow your options and improve your overall buying experience.

Costs to Consider
- Purchase price
- Closing expenses
- Property maintenance
- Insurance costs
- Utility expenses
- Future property improvements
Evaluating all potential costs can help you prepare for long-term ownership.

What costs should first-time buyers plan for?
In addition to the purchase price, buyers should consider closing expenses, insurance, maintenance costs, utilities, and any future property improvements they may wish to make.
